RICHARD A. KATZ was admitted to practice in New York in 1967 and to practice before the U.S. District Court, Southern District of New York in 1968. Mr. Katz specializes in the areas of Corporate Law, Commercial Law, Real Estate Law, Trusts and Estates Law and Elder Law.
Mr. Katz is a member of the American Association of Homes and Services for the Aging, Chairman of the Board of The New York Institute for Medical Research, Inc. and was previously a Co-Chairman of the Institutional Review Board of Gracie Square Hospital. Mr. Katz is also a member of the Rockland County Bar Association, the American Health Lawyers and the Estate Planning Council of Rockland County. His clients include elder care facilities, nursing homes, major and family business concerns, telecommunication companies and individuals. He regularly lectures to businesses and professionals on trusts and estate planning.
Mr. Katz received his law degree from Brooklyn Law School and graduated with a Bachelor of Arts degree from Hunter College of the City of New York.
